Police arrest Tilburg man suspected of raping woman in random King’s Night attack

A man from Tilburg was arrested on Wednesday in connection with the random sexual assault of a woman in a city center alleyway during King’s Night. The man was arrested in his home in the Noord-Brabant city at 6:10 a.m., police said later in the day.

He is accused of raping the 24-year-old woman during the overnight hours early on Sunday in a shocking attack after the woman enjoyed a night out in the center. “She was violently sexually abused by a man in the area of ​​Korte Tuinstraat,” police said.

Bystanders found the “very upset” woman, and escorted her to the police station, where she filed a report. The woman said that she did not know the man who assaulted her.

Police said that the man had a light skin complexion. People in the area noted that a man in red pants was bothering women throughout the night.

Investigators managed to gather camera footage which may have shown the suspect fleeing the scene of the crime. Those developments led police to consider the 31-year-old suspect, who was taken into custody on behalf of the Public Prosecution Service, police said.

Residents of the nearby area were shocked by the incident. “Really bizarre,” a resident told Omroep Brabant. “A rape in the middle of the city while the nightlife crowd is wandering home.” Another resident responded. Those living in the area said they were shocked that an incident like this could happen just a few meters away from a crowded district where people were returning home from the King’s Night festivities.
